Which behavior can reduce pollution that occurs due to the use of coal?
mixas84 [53]

Answer:

A

Explanation:

Coal is majorly used to produces electricity. The coal is ignited and the heat produced used to heat water to steam. The steam is then used to drive turbines with a dynamo effect to produce electricity. Turning off lights when not in use reduces the demand for electricity hence reducing the amount of coal needed to meet this demand.

Other ways to conserve energy is using bulbs with low energy demand - such as LEDs - and  improving natural lighting indoors.

Which one of the following statements presents a condition of the Hardy-Weinberg principle? A. Gene flow is present. B. Genetic
Nitella [24]
The statement in the given question that presents a condition of the Hardy-Weinberg principle is that random mating occurs. The correct option among all the options given in the question is option "C". There are definitely certain conditions under which the Hardy- Weinberg principle occurs and they are when there is no gene flow, no mutations happen, no generic drift occurs and random mating occurs. This principle also states a very important aspect and it is that genotype and allele frequencies will always remain constant from one generation to another if there is absence of other evolutionary inflrnce.
